We are looking for a Freelance Trainer with Automotive Industry experience for upcoming training and coaching projects with leading premium and luxury brands. Who We Are Founded in 2006, CXG is a global customer experience agency specializing in the premium and luxury industries. We serve over 200 luxury clients with a multicultural team of 250+ professionals. Our mission is to help brands transform customer and employee experiences through tailored insights, strategy, and implementation. We are passionate about delivering impact. Our clients include the world’s most admired luxury houses, and our solutions combine research, technology, and human expertise to elevate every customer interaction. Role Summary As a freelance trainer, you will collaborate with our team on a project basis to deliver high-impact learning experiences that drive real change on the ground. Depending on project needs, your responsibilities may include: Understanding our clients’ learning objectives and tailoring training to their brand and business needs Liaising with Project Managers and internal teams to align on training objectives, content, and schedules Supporting the design and development of impactful training programs and materials Delivering engaging training sessions both in-person and online (e.g., retail programs, workshops, coaching) Creating a vivid and dynamic learning environment to inspire mindset shifts and develop practical skills Using a mix of methodologies such as discussion, demonstration, storytelling, and gamification to drive engagement Providing coaching support (on the floor or remotely) to reinforce learning and elevate performance Requirements What you will bring along: Strong background in luxury retail with a focus on service excellence and customer experience in the automotive industry A minimum of 5+ years of experience in service excellence, customer experience (CX), and training Expertise in conducting classroom training, workshops, and on-field coaching, covering topics such as customer experience mindset, emotional selling, service excellence, and clienteling/CRM for retail frontline teams Proven experience in delivering engaging and interactive learning activities Excellent communication skills, with proficiency in English Ability to develop training materials and activities is a plus
